  • CTIA vs. OMTP Requirements

    The three.5mm TRRS connector has two major wiring requirements: CTIA (Mobile Phone Industries Affiliation) and OMTP (Open Cell Terminal Platform). Whereas most fashionable units adhere to CTIA, older Android units could have utilized OMTP. The microphone and floor pins are swapped between these requirements. Adapters designed to bridge iPhone headsets (sometimes CTIA) and Android units should account for these differing requirements, incorporating a switching mechanism or cross-wired connections to make sure the microphone sign is routed appropriately. A mismatch between requirements results in both no microphone operate or vital audio distortion.

4. Adapter Sorts

The performance achieved when adapting an iPhone headset to be used with an Android gadget is contingent upon the particular sort of adapter employed. Variations exist based mostly on connection interfaces, inside circuitry, and supported options, straight influencing compatibility and efficiency. As an example, passive adapters, which consist solely of wired connections rerouting the three.5mm TRRS pinout, provide minimal compatibility and sometimes fail to assist microphone performance or inline controls. In distinction, energetic adapters incorporate digital elements, corresponding to microcontrollers and digital sign processors, to actively translate and modify audio alerts, thereby enhancing compatibility and enabling options corresponding to quantity management and microphone assist. The choice of an inappropriate adapter sort invariably results in compromised audio high quality or full useful failure, underscoring the vital position adapter sorts play in realizing efficient cross-platform headset compatibility.

USB-C to three.5mm adapters additional complicate the panorama. Trendy Android units more and more lack a devoted 3.5mm headphone jack, necessitating using USB-C adapters. These adapters could be both passive or energetic, just like commonplace 3.5mm adapters. Nonetheless, the USB-C interface permits for extra refined digital audio processing and management, doubtlessly enabling greater audio constancy and enhanced management performance. For instance, an energetic USB-C to three.5mm adapter could incorporate a built-in digital-to-analog converter (DAC) to bypass the Android gadget’s inside audio processing, leading to improved sound high quality. Conversely, a passive USB-C adapter depends on the Android gadget’s inside DAC, doubtlessly limiting audio efficiency. The selection between passive and energetic USB-C adapters is due to this fact paramount in figuring out the general audio expertise.

  • Digital-to-Analog Conversion (DAC)

    For adapters that join by way of USB-C, the presence and high quality of a built-in Digital-to-Analog Converter (DAC) change into vital. If the Android gadget lacks a 3.5mm headphone jack, the USB-C adapter should carry out the digital-to-analog conversion to supply an audible sign. A low-quality DAC can introduce distortion, cut back dynamic vary, and alter the frequency response of the audio. Excessive-end adapters incorporate devoted DAC chips with superior specs, leading to improved audio readability and element. The selection of DAC straight determines the standard of the audio output, with higher-quality DACs providing a extra trustworthy replica of the unique audio sign.
